Why Garden Renovation Waste Is Different From Ordinary Household Rubbish
Garden renovation waste has two characteristics that make it particularly difficult to handle. First, it tends to be extremely heavy. A cubic metre of wet clay soil, common across much of Surrey and Sussex, can weigh close to 2 tonnes. Turf, old concrete, hardcore and paving slabs are similarly dense. Second, it tends to accumulate in large, irregular piles that are difficult to load manually into a skip without significant physical effort or additional labour.
Skips have a fixed weight limit, and garden waste has a habit of exceeding it before the container looks anywhere near full. As a result, homeowners find themselves paying for a skip they cannot fill to capacity, or worse, discovering they need a second one at additional cost. Furthermore, placing a skip on a driveway or front garden during a renovation ties up space that your landscaper or groundwork contractor needs to work in, and waiting for it to be collected and replaced creates delays that cost time and money on a project where momentum matters.

How Grab Hire Solves Every One of Those Problems
A Holdens grab lorry arrives at your property, and the operator uses a long-reach hydraulic arm to lift and load your garden renovation waste directly onto the vehicle, without anyone needing to manually shovel or carry a single barrow load. The arm can reach over fences and walls, into areas that would otherwise require significant access, and load material from spots that a skip could never reach from the road. Once the lorry is loaded, it leaves. The whole process typically takes less than an hour and requires no skip sitting on your property for days or weeks whilst you fill it gradually.
Additionally, our 8-wheel grab lorries carry up to 16 tonnes of waste per trip, making them extraordinarily well-suited to the heavy, dense materials generated by garden renovations. Soil, turf, rubble, concrete, and hardcore are all handled in a single load, where a skip might require two or three collections of progressively smaller containers to stay within weight limits. Consequently, grab hire is faster, more space-efficient, and in many cases considerably cheaper than the skip alternative for this type of work.

Common Questions About Grab Hire for Garden Waste
Can a grab lorry collect mixed garden waste, including soil, turf and rubble together?
Yes, in most cases. Our grab lorries handle soil, turf, green waste, rubble, hardcore, concrete, and old paving slabs efficiently. However, it is worth keeping hazardous materials, such as asbestos or contaminated soil, separate, as they require specialist disposal. If you are unsure about any specific materials on your site, simply give us a call before booking, and we will advise you straightforwardly.
Do I need a permit for a grab lorry to collect from my property?
No. Unlike a skip, which requires a council permit if it is to sit on a public road, a grab lorry arrives, collects, and leaves within a single visit. No permit is required, and there is no extended presence on the road outside your property. It is one of the most practical advantages of grab hire for domestic garden renovation projects.
